When you look at getting a fireplace installed, several variables change the final bill. The biggest factor is the type of unit you choose—gas, wood-burning, or electric models all have different requirements. You also have to consider your home's existing ventilation and whether a chimney or direct-vent pipe needs to be built from scratch. If we need to run new gas lines or electrical circuits, that adds labor time and complexity. Your ex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.
When budgeting for a fireplace, consider the complexity of the gas or chimney line extensions required. Projects that involve adding a new external vent or modifying interior walls will shift the total cost upward. The '2 + 10 rule' typically refers to safety clearances around a fireplace. It usually means 2 inches of clearance from combustible materials directly beside the opening and 10 inches above. Licensed professionals will ensure all safety codes are followed.

The installation of a fireplace involves preparing the opening, running gas lines if needed, installing the firebox or unit, setting up the correct venting and chimney system, and ensuring all safety clearances are maintained. The process differs based on fireplace type.
